About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- Oversees all aspects of the education program to assure compliance with accreditation agency, college, and clinical affiliates.
- Develops, implements and evaluates curriculum content and structure in accordance with accreditation and College standards.
- Assures curriculum development in accordance with the mandates of the accrediting agency and college.
- Assesses the quality of education and implements solutions to improve program education.
- Develops policies and procedures consistent with accreditation requirements for all phases of student education.
Requirements
What you’ll need- Bachelor’s degree unless otherwise required by accreditation agency
- Minimum 4 years relevant work experience required
- Ability to meet all relevant qualifications for Program Coordinator as required for Program Accreditation
- Credentials in specialty and in good standing with pertinent regulatory agencies.
